Category | Compound | Model | Alterations of GM | Alterations of lipids | Main effects | Reference |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Polyphenols | Hawthorn flavonoid | D-galactose and aluminum chloride induced AD mice | Dubosiella↑, Alloprevotella↑, Bifidobacterium↑, Acinetobacter↓, | Docosapentaenoic acid↑, sphingolipid↑, PC↑ | Ameliorated Aβ accumulation and abnormal activation of hippocampal microglia, improved cognitive deficits | [251] |
Curcumin | APP/PS1 mice, BV2 Microglial Cells | Prevotellaceae,↓ Bacteroides↓, Escherichia/Shigella↓ | TREM2 expression↑ | Inhibits neuroinflammation, reduce the amyloid plaque burden, improve the spatial learning and memory abilities | ||
Bilberry anthocyanins | APP/PS1 mice | Serum and brain LPS levels↓, | SCFAs↑ | Decreases hippocampal neuroinflammatory responses, Aβ plaques, reverse cognitive disfunction | [254] | |
Luteolin | / | Butyrate↑, Neurotoxin cytokines↓, LPS↓,TMAO↓ | SCFAs↑ | Reduce neuroinflammation, intracellular tau-related neurofibrillary tangles and extracellular Aβ deposition | [264] | |
Herbal medicines | Schisandra chinensis | Aβ injection SD rats | Lactobacillus↑, Firmicutes↑, Bacteroidetes↑, Pseudomonadaceae_Pseudomonas↓,butyrate↑, propionate↑, | SCFAs↑ | Improved learning and memory capacity, reduced neuroinflammation, and restoration of the integrity of the intestinal barrier | [257] |
Epimedii Folium and Curculiginis Rhizoma | LPS-induced neuroinflammatory mouse model | LPS↓ | TREM2 expression↑,APOE expression↓ | Inhibited neuroinflammation, ameliorated cognitive impairment | [260] | |
Pyrolae herba | LPS injection C57BL6/J mice | LPS↓ | TREM2 expression↓ | Reduce pro-inflammatory factors, improve cognitive function | [261] | |
Statin | Atorvastatin | SD rats | Lactobacillus↑, Blautia↓, Ruminococcaceae↓ | RA metabolism↑ | Inhibit neuroinflammation, improve cognitive decline | [265] |
Simvastatin | Ovariectomized/D-galactose AD rat | Propionic acid↑, acetic acid↑, butyric acid↑, tight junctions of intestinal cells↑ | SCFAs↑ | Decreased cell death and Aβ plaques, reducted neuronal inflammation, protected learning and memory function | [263] |
